And yet, beauty alone, glorious as it is, doesn't always cut it. The truth is, accessibility and modern comforts are key. And this is where Uttarakhand has, quite cleverly, stepped up its game. Think about it: the much-talked-about Char Dham all-weather road project, new railway lines snaking through previously unreachable terrain, and expanding airports – these aren't just engineering feats; they are gateways. They’re making it genuinely easier for couples, their guests, and film crews, along with all their heavy equipment, to reach these otherwise pristine, sometimes remote, locations.

This isn’t just about picturesque photos, of course. Beneath the surface, there's a serious economic ripple effect at play. Boosting tourism, particularly high-value segments like destination weddings and film shoots, translates directly into local jobs, empowers small businesses, and, in essence, breathes new life into the state's economy.
